问题标签 [watchos-2]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
4 回答
9129 浏览

ios - Apple Watch 的预处理器宏?

我正在查看 Apple 的Lister(用于 Apple Watch、iOS 和 OS X)示例。该示例针对 iOS 和 OS X 执行测试:

但是,没有测试TARGET_OS_WATCH或类似的测试。Grepping for watchinTargetConditionals.h没有命中:

TargetConditionals.h,我知道有:

:苹果手表有预处理器吗?


我用进行标记,但我不确定这是否是这个问题的正确操作系统。

下面的列表是从 iPhone 的TargetConditionals.h. Simulator 和 OS X 类似(它们只是将不同的位设置为 1):

问题:手表用TARGET_OS_EMBEDDED吗?手表省略了 TARGET_OS_IPHONE吗?

0 投票
1 回答
453 浏览

watchkit - WatchKit:设置标题延迟?

当我在 WatchKit 中推送一个新控制器并在新控制器的 awakeWithContext: 方法中使用 setTitle 时,设置标题需要一秒钟左右,直到那时它保持空白。当我在情节提要中设置标题时,它会立即出现。

我错过了什么还是这是预期的行为?

0 投票
3 回答
1908 浏览

xcode - WatchKit 无效的二进制文件

我已经使用我的 WatchKit 扩展上传了一个应用更新,但它在 iTunes Connect 中一直显示“无效二进制”。我是否需要告诉 iTunes Connect 它应该在任何地方包含一个 WatchKit 应用程序?

0 投票
5 回答
9053 浏览

objective-c - 如何在 Apple Watch 上显示警报

如何在 Apple Watch 上显示警报。是否有任何替代方法可以在 Apple Watch 中显示警报,因为我检查了 UIAlertView 在 Apple Watch 上不起作用。

0 投票
2 回答
340 浏览

ios - watchkit 中的 LongPressGestureRecognizer

当我长按 watchkit 中的按钮时,我正在尝试执行一些操作。
如何在 Watchkit 中使用长按手势WKInterfaceButton

0 投票
3 回答
3946 浏览

watchkit - watchOS 2 心率传感器

有谁知道如何访问 Xcode 7 beta 中 watchOS 2 中可用的心率传感器?

0 投票
4 回答
1244 浏览

watchkit - animateWithDuration 缺少完成块,WatchOS 2

watchOS 2 在其 animateWithDuration 函数中没有任何类型的完成块。我正在开发一个需要在动画完成后运行代码的游戏。有解决办法吗?也许使用键值观察?另一种方法是使用与动画长度相匹配的计时器,但由于显而易见的原因,这并不理想。

0 投票
2 回答
1368 浏览

ios - 使用 openSystem API 从 Apple Watch 拨打电话?

当我观看 WWDC 2015 会议视频“Introducing WatchKit for watchOS 2”(13:29)时,我看到可以使用 openSystem API 在 Apple Watch 上直接拨打电话。如何在 Swift 中使用这个 API?

0 投票
1 回答
210 浏览

ios - 在 WatchKit 项目中无法识别 presentAudioRecordingControllerWithOutputURL

我有一个 WatchKit 的现有项目,并且在新的 WatchOS 版本中,Apple 实现了一种名为presentAudioRecordingControllerWithOutputURL从 AppleWatch 录制音频的方法。

当我调用这个方法时,我有两个编译错误。我想我必须添加或包含更多内容,但我不知道我必须在我的项目中更改什么。

在此处输入图像描述

错误:

0 投票
2 回答
418 浏览

watchkit - 我可以同时使用具有自定义背景图像和复杂功能的 ClockKit 吗?

我想使用带有自定义图像的表盘(如 WWCD'15 主题演讲中所示),同时显示复杂性。我怎样才能做到这一点?

我研究了ClockKit 文档,但找不到这样做的方法。

更新:似乎watchOS 2提供了带有自定义图像的表盘。但是,此表盘不允许添加复杂功能。